What to expect

This course provides insights into state of the art applications of modern Cardiac Radiology, and will be organised as a multimodality course discussing the most relevant clinical applications of both Cardiac CT and MR. Presentations will provide clear recommendations for optimised imaging protocols as well as structured approach to reporting, with a specific focus on the implementation of most actual clinical guidelines into the clinical routine, including the guidelines on cardiac oncology, on myocardial inflammation, as well as on management of aortic diseases. A modern, outcome-based approach to the diagnosis of coronary artery disease will be discussed.

learning objectives

  • To understand the importance of image based diagnose of hypertrophic phenotypes

  • To learn about the new guidelines about imaging diagnosis of the myopericardial inflammatory syndrome

  • To analyse the clinical value of Cardiac CT in coronary artery disease.

  • To become familiar with the recent guidelines of diagnosis and management of aortic diseases
